Mera (6460m) & Island Peak (6189m) are two of the most popular trekking peaks in the Nepal Himalaya and this expedition combines attempts on both mountains with a trek through the remote Honku Valley and a crossing of the spectacular and difficult Amphu Laptsa Pass. The generous itinerary ensures proper acclimatisation and we have plenty of contingency days in the event of inclement weather. Being slightly to the south of the main range, Mera offers spectacular views from Kangchenjunga in the east to the Langtang region in the west. Island Peak is situated right in the heart of the Khumbu area and although it is dwarfed by the enormous Lhotse Face to the north, the views from the summit are truly exceptional.

Outlined Itinerary :
Day 01: Arrival at Kathmandu International Airport and transfer to hotel. Stay overnight at hotel in Kathmandu. Day 02: Fly to Lukla (2800m) & commence trekking to Puiyan (approx 2800m). Day 03: Trek to Pangom (2800m). Day 04: Nashing Dingma (2600m). Day 05: Chalem Kharka (3600m) Day 06: Chunbu Kharka (4200m) Day 07: Rest day at Chunbu Kharka Day 08: To Hinku valley camp (approx 3600m ) Day 09: To Tagnag (4400m) Day 10: Acclimatisation Day/preparations Days 11/15: To Base Camp (5000m) and Summit attempt on Mera (6460m) Day 16: Rest & Contingency Day Days 17/18: Commence trek into the Hunku Valley Day 19: Rest day. Final preparations and gear checks for our pass crossing. Days 20/21: Cross Amphu Laptsa (5845m) to Island Peak Base Camp (5100m). Day 22: Contingency Day. Final preparations and a check of snow and weather conditions before attempting the summit of Island Peak. Day 23: Summit Island Peak. Days 24/26: Trek to Namche Bazaar. We begin our exit trek descending through the famous Khumbu Valley to Namche Bazaar. Day 27: Trek to Lukla which takes about nine hours. Day 28: Fly to Kathmandu (1330m). Stay overnight at hotel in Kathmandu on breakfast basis. Day 29: Depart from Nepal. After breakfast trip concludes with a transfer to the airport.
